Stock portfolio optimization through artificial intelligence algorithm: comparison of stock portfolio in terms of risk-taking and investor cautionAbstractThe process of selecting stock portfolios for investment is one of the issues that has been considered by many researchers. In decision making for investment, two factors are very important and are the basis of investment. These two factors are risk and return, and in this regard, investors are studied to select the best investment portfolio according to the amount of risk and return. The purpose of this research is to create an intelligent model for selecting the optimal stock portfolio using research algorithms. The proposed model examines the different types of investments that an investor can and is willing to consider in order to form his or her investment portfolio. For this purpose, the expected risk and return of companies listed on the Tehran Stock Exchange have been examined on a monthly basis. The statistical sample of the research includes the financial data of 237 Iranian stock exchange companies during the years 1390 to 1398. The results show that the LISFLA algorithm is able to select a portfolio using the Marquis model for risk-averse and risk-averse investors.Keywords: stock portfolio, risk, return, frog algorithm
